A concours restoration packing an original Boss 429ci V8 engine. This fully documented Boss KK 429 NASCAR 2153 was assembled in September 1969 in Dearborn, MI, and is the beneficiary of a ground-up, concours restoration conducted by the experts at Shelby Parts & Restoration of Green Bay, WI. This Mustang's high-quality reboot was supplemented with many original and NOS parts. Once the collection of components was smooth and properly aligned, a correct coat of Grabber Blue 2-stage was accented with a correct black hood scoop. Now polished and professionally sorted, this coupe rolls with its original, Boss 429ci Ford V8 engine that, in its fully restored state, mimics assembly-line aesthetics. Behind that mill, a correct Toploader 4-speed manual transmission wears a correct RUG-AZ assembly tag. The gearbox spins a correct Drag Pack axle, which is finished with correct 3.91 gears and a correct Traction-Lok differential. The drivetrain rolls on a correct Competition Suspension. At the ends of that suspension, correct power steering combines with correct power front disc and rear drum brakes to provide competent track capability. At the sides of those tubes, chrome Magnum 500s twist reproduction F60-15 Goodyear Polyglas GTs. The interior sports correct white Clarion Knit vinyl with Corinthian bucket seats. The sale includes a Marti Works Elite Report and an Eminger document.
